Exposure to asbestos dust generally leads to serious illnesses many years later
Many hard working individuals such as shipfitters, pipefitters and demolition workers have developed serious illnesses such as mesothelioma, lung cancer, and asbestosis from exposure to asbestos dust.
Sadly, many of these diligent people were not informed that they were being exposed to asbestos dust either by their employers or asbestos manufacturers. Their illnesses developed many years after their exposure to asbestos dust. Shockingly, in some cases, the loved ones of these hard working people also developed asbestos illnesses from inhaling asbestos fibers that clung to the clothes of those who worked with asbestos.
